Subtitles via Watch Live are supported on most of our programming and platforms (Amazon, Roku, iOS, Android and within a web browser) however not everything will carry subtitles either because none are available or, as in the case of some of our older content, because the subtitle format is not compatible (e.g Everybody Loves Raymond, Frasier, etc.). If subtitles are available, an 'S' button will be visible on screen.

Wi-Fi is a short-range static wireless connection. To use it for internet access, your device must connect (over Wi-Fi) to a wireless router – such as the one at your favourite coffee shop that allows customers free internet access. Mobile data is usually available on your device as part of a paid contract or on pay as you go services. It allows you to browse the internet or stream content anywhere you can access a strong enough signal.

Mobile data is an internet source - such as GPRS, Edge, 2G, 3G or 4G - supplied by your mobile phone provider. Mobile data does not include WiFi. The amount of mobile data available to you will vary based on your mobile contract and is usually limited to a certain number of gigabytes of data each month.
